1. BLUF (Bottom Line Up Front)
The report examines the significant decrease in deportations under Donald Trump’s administration compared to Barack Obama’s tenure. Despite Trump’s promises of large-scale deportations, his administration has not matched the deportation levels seen under Obama. Key factors include strategic shifts in immigration enforcement, legal and political challenges, and changes in border crossing dynamics. Recommendations focus on reassessing deportation strategies and addressing systemic obstacles.
